Exterior Painting Is Preventive Home Maintenance

Painting the outside of a home isn’t simply about refreshing its appearance.

It’s also part of maintaining one of your largest investments.

Quality exterior coatings help shield siding from rain, humidity, ultraviolet rays, and seasonal temperature changes. As those coatings naturally age, moisture has a greater opportunity to reach the materials underneath, increasing the likelihood of repairs that could have been prevented through routine maintenance.

Keeping exterior paint in good condition helps preserve both the beauty and structural integrity of your home.

Nature Has a Bigger Impact Than You May Realize

Homes in Pisgah Forest enjoy a beautiful setting surrounded by trees, mountain landscapes, and abundant rainfall.

Those same natural surroundings also influence how exterior paint ages.

Homes near wooded areas often collect more pollen, leaves, sap, and moisture than homes in more open neighborhoods. Shaded surfaces stay damp longer after rain, while areas exposed to direct afternoon sunlight may experience more fading over time.

Recognizing these differences allows each area of the home to receive the preparation and attention it requires rather than treating every surface exactly the same.

Preparation Is Where Long-Lasting Results Begin

Many homeowners understandably focus on the finished appearance.

Professional painters often focus first on everything that happens before the first coat of paint is applied.

Exterior surfaces are carefully cleaned to remove dirt, mildew, loose paint, pollen, and other contaminants that prevent proper adhesion. During this stage, small repairs can also be identified and addressed before fresh coatings conceal them.

Proper preparation provides a stable foundation that helps new paint perform as intended for years instead of seasons.

Siding and Trim Protect Different Parts of Your Home

Large sections of siding receive constant exposure to the weather.

Trim protects many of the areas where moisture is most likely to collect.

Window trim, fascia boards, soffits, corner boards, and decorative molding all help seal transitions between building materials. These locations expand and contract with changing temperatures and often require careful attention during an exterior painting project.

Painting both siding and trim together creates a more complete layer of protection while giving the home’s exterior a clean, balanced appearance.

Decks and Porches Face Everyday Wear

Outdoor living areas experience challenges that vertical walls never encounter.

Foot traffic, outdoor furniture, standing water, sunlight, and seasonal debris all contribute to gradual wear on painted or stained wood surfaces.

Preparing decks and porches correctly before applying fresh coatings helps improve adhesion while protecting the wood underneath. Regular maintenance also helps these spaces remain attractive gathering places for family and friends throughout the year.

Doors, Windows, and Trim Deserve Individual Attention

Some of the smallest parts of your home’s exterior often require the most detailed workmanship.

Doors and window frames are opened and closed every day. Trim pieces surround corners, joints, and transitions where different building materials meet. These areas experience constant movement as temperatures change and are frequently exposed to moisture.

Preparing these surfaces carefully before painting helps fresh coatings bond properly while creating clean lines that complement the rest of the home’s exterior. Paying attention to these details also helps protect vulnerable areas where weather can gradually take its toll.

Fence Painting Helps Protect Your Entire Property

Fences rarely receive the same attention as the home itself, yet they face the same weather every day.

Rain, humidity, sunshine, and changing temperatures gradually wear away protective coatings. Left untreated, wood fences may begin absorbing more moisture, leading to discoloration, cracking, or premature aging.

Painting or refinishing a fence starts with proper cleaning and preparation. Once completed, it provides another layer of defense against the elements while helping the entire property maintain a well-cared-for appearance.

Pisgah Forest’s Seasonal Temperatures Matter

Living in Pisgah Forest means enjoying beautiful mountain scenery, abundant forests, and four distinct seasons.

Those seasonal changes also affect exterior building materials.

Pisgah Forest’s seasonal temperatures typically include warm, humid summers and cool winters, with regular rainfall throughout much of the year. As siding, trim, decks, and other exterior surfaces repeatedly warm, cool, expand, and contract, paint naturally begins to age.

Scheduling exterior painting during appropriate weather conditions allows coatings to cure correctly and provide dependable protection through changing seasons.
